AbstractA weighing lysimeter which consists of a steel tank, a 2,000 kg platform type balance, and an outer cemented brick tank was constructed, installed and tested at the centre of a 10 m x 10 m field plot in Asian Institute of Technology experimental station, Bangkok. The daily evapotranspiration of maize was measured throughout the growth period during the dry season. The soil moisture content was kept at field capacity by replenishing the soil moisture daily. Tensiometers were used for measuring soil moisture content within the lysimeter. The total crop requirement for the whole experiment period i .e. one growing season was found to be 404 mm. The ET/E pan ratio were calculated and plotted against the different growth stages.
